The National Monuments Service's description

Marked as a D-shaped field on the 1837 ed. of the OS 6-inch map and as a hachured enclosure on the 1915 ed. It is situated at the edge of a shelf which slopes down gently to the NE. D-shaped grass-covered area (dims 88.5m NW-SE; 69m NE-SW) defined by a grass-covered earth and stone bank (Wth 3.5-4.2m; int. H 0.5-0.6m; ext. H 0.5-1.8m) with the straight side at NE where the bank is reduced to a scarp (H 0.8m). An outer fosse (Wth of top 3.5m; Wth of base 1.6m; D 0.8m) survives only at W (L c. 30m) where there is a sharp angle. There are entrances at NW (Wth 4.5m) and SE (Wth 14m) associated with a trackway, and there are lazy-beds in the interior. There is a tradition of its use as a children's burial ground (RO044-084003-), but no evidence of this. Enclosure (RO044-085----) is c. 120m to the SE.
